Indian Postal department use Postal Index Number(PIN) or Pincode for post office numbering. PIN code of Pandranu B.O (171206) is a 6 digit code is used to find out delivery Post Offices in district in India. The PIN codes are divided in 9 zones. The first digit "1" represents the region i.e. Himachal Pradesh The second digit "7" represents the sub-region i.e. Shimla HQ, and the third digit "1" represents the district of that region i.e. Shimla.
